Forex Market Report - 25th July 2024
Our forex market report offers an overview of critical economic and financial events that impact the global forex markets. Traders should closely monitor developments to fine-tune their trading strategies accordingly.

1. USD Movement
- The Federal Reserve's latest statements hint at a potential pause in interest rate hikes, affecting the USD's strength.
- Recent U.S. economic data shows mixed results, with a slight increase in consumer spending but stagnant manufacturing output.
- Traders are closely watching upcoming employment data for further clues on economic direction and Fed policy.
2. EUR Developments
- The European Central Bank (ECB) signaled readiness for additional monetary tightening if inflation does not ease.
- German industrial production figures have shown a decline, raising concerns about the Eurozone’s largest economy.
- Political instability in Italy is causing some volatility in the EUR, with coalition tensions impacting market confidence.
3. GBP Trends
- The Bank of England (BoE) is maintaining a cautious stance, weighing the need for further rate hikes against economic slowdown risks.
- UK inflation remains high, prompting debates on fiscal policies to counter rising living costs.
- Ongoing Brexit trade negotiations, particularly around Northern Ireland, are adding layers of uncertainty to GBP movements.
4. JPY Insights
- The Bank of Japan (BoJ) continues its ultra-loose monetary policy, resulting in a weaker JPY amid global currency fluctuations.
- Japan's export figures have improved slightly, but the trade balance remains negative due to high import costs.
- Market participants are monitoring BoJ Governor's speeches for any signs of a shift in monetary policy.
5. Commodity-Linked Currencies
- The Australian dollar (AUD) is under pressure from declining commodity prices and mixed domestic economic data.
- The Canadian dollar (CAD) benefits from stable oil prices, although future price volatility could impact its strength.
- The New Zealand dollar (NZD) is influenced by dairy price trends and central bank policy signals, with recent data indicating potential economic resilience.
